Yahaya Bello Breaks Silence on Rumors of 2027 Showdown with Tinubu

 

Former Kogi State Governor Yahaya Bello has declared he will not contest against President Bola Ahmed Tinubu in the 2027 presidential election, reaffirming his full support for the President’s re-election bid.

 

In a statement issued by Ohiare Michael, Director of the Yahaya Bello Media Office, Bello praised Tinubu’s leadership and achievements, despite global challenges. “On merit, he deserves the support of well-meaning Nigerians,” the statement read.

 

Bello dismissed recent speculation suggesting he is preparing for a presidential run in 2027, calling it baseless. The speculation followed the circulation of an old photo from a 2022 rally, which some blogs falsely presented as a current event. The media office criticized what it described as the work of “witless bloggers” and “frustrated detractors” attempting to sow discord between Bello and the President.

 

“Our attention has been drawn to another senseless post by mischief makers, who have no other job than to fabricate falsehood and disseminate same to mislead unsuspecting Nigerians,” the statement noted. It emphasized that the rally photos being recirculated clearly show a 2022 date and should not be misinterpreted.

 

Bello’s team reiterated his loyalty to President Tinubu and advised Nigerians to disregard misleading reports suggesting otherwise.
